What digs holes?

Animals like moles, gophers, and groundhogs are known for digging holes. They dig tunnels underground to create homes, find food, or move around easily. Other creatures, like some species of rodents and insects, may also dig holes for nesting or hiding purposes.

Do snakes dig holes your neighbor has small 4-5 mounds of dirt about the same size around beside holes in the ground that she claims are snake holes Is that possible?

Some snakes dig their own burrows, but many just use holes dug by other animals. Many animals dig holes in the ground - several holes in one area are more likely to be some animal digging for food.
